摘 要:目的:优化拟缺香茶菜总黄酮提取工艺。方法:采用L9(34)正交试验,以拟缺香茶菜总黄酮的含量为综合指标,采取加热回流方法,考察提取温度(A)、液料比(B)、提取时间(C)、乙醇浓度(D)4个因素对提取效果的影响。结果:最佳提取工艺为温度90℃、液料比40∶1、提取2.0 h、60%乙醇,平均得率为5.668 6%。结论:该工艺简便合理,稳定可行,可为拟缺香茶菜总黄酮提取工艺的确定提供依据。Objective:The optimal conditions of total flavonoids from Isodon excisoides were investigated by orthogonal array design.Methods:The content of total flavonoids was determined spectrometrically using rutin as the reference substance.The effects of extraction temperature,extraction time,liquid/material ratio,ethanol concentration on the content of total flavonoids in extracts were investigated by one-factor-at-a-time method,and the extraction conditions were optimized by orthogonal array design.Results:Ethanol concentration and liquid/material ratio were the key factors that affected the extraction of total flavonoids.The optimal extractive conditions were obtained as follows:temperature 90 ℃,treatment time 120 min,liquid/material ratio 50∶1 and ethanol concentration 50%.Under these conditions,the extraction yield of total flavonoids from I.excisoides was 5.668 6%.Conclusion:The optimized process remarkably increases the extraction yield of total flavonoids from I.excisoides and has a promising prospect for practical applications.
